In the Nov. 21 edition of the Chronicle, Mr. Smarty Pants Knows said that the Hawaiian alphabet has 12 letters. In fact, it has 12 letters from the Latin alphabet, plus a 13th "letter" called "'okina" that is written with an apostrophe ('). Mr. Smarty Pants wishes to say he is sorry, but since there is apparently no word in Hawaiian for sorry, he will have to say, "e kala mai i a'u," which translates to "please forgive me."
In the Chronicle's City Council endorsements (published Nov. 28 and online), due to errors in editing, mistakes were introduced into the District 10 endorsement: Specifically, Sheri Gallo is not a legislative aide, nor has she signed the local "tax-cut pledge." We've corrected the endorsement accordingly, and apologize to Gallo and our readers for the errors.
In "The Lege Stirs Into Action" (Nov. 21): As currently drafted, Senate Bill 119 by Sen. Donna Campbell will require San Antonio's VIA Metropolitan Transit, not Capital Metro, to have an elected board. However, Cap Metro spokesman John Julitz noted, "These things can change over the course of a session."
